    Katherine B.

    Overall I would give this restaurant 4.5 stars but the taste is 6 out of 5 stars. The taste BLEW us away. We have tried so many amazing restaurants, and I can easily say I've never seen my friend THIS satisfied after a meal. Repeatedly talking about how good the food was hours after we had finished. The sauce is perfect. We got medium spice. We loved it without the limes but then we added some lime juice and it took it to the next level. Everything was perfectly cooked. I mean the food couldn't have been better, truly. Now they prep everything to order which is amazing, but means that this can take a long time. I came to order this tray before the USA vs Paraguay World Cup game (I lived in PY which is why we splurged a little on this) and unfortunately I ended up missing the first goal because it took over 45 minutes for this order to be ready. Part of it was bad timing - there were 3 in-person orders ahead of me and an online pickup. I would definitely order online next time. Everyone was very nice, you order at the window, and you can eat there on their patio area or take it to go. The patio area has some great covered tables with fans to keep away the flies. Make sure you ask for bibs if you are getting your order to go! That's the only thing we were missing. This is in a residential area so parking is pretty impacted, but surprisingly I found a great spot right away! I know we will be back over and over again. We are still not over how delicious this meal was!

    Tracy N.

    Showed up on a Friday afternoon and there was no wait luckily. Located right inside a neighborhood with plenty of street parking. I didn't see a restroom but not sure if they had one around the sign or something. You order at the window then seat yourself at their outdoor seating. They had umbrellas covering most tables but not all of them I like that each pound of seafood at this place comes with corn, potatoes, and sausage since most places don't do that. I think there was only one sauce option and you can just choose spice level We ordered one pound each of snow crab, crawfish, and mussels with medium spice level. Each pound came in a separate bag but they also gave us a tray when we asked for it. The sauce was good and had a light kick but not too spicy. The seafood itself was good, only thing is the mussels were kinda small

    Grace C.

    That shrimp boil was hitting--juicy shrimp, sausage, corn, and potatoes ALL included and drenched in that buttery, garlicky, spicy sauce ‍ Every bite had flavor, no dry spots at all. I also love that you can choose how you want your shrimp--head-on for extra flavor, no head, or even already peeled if you don't wanna do the work . The sauce itself is the highlight. It's very garlicky, buttery, and has a good kick, you can literally just put the sauce on top of white rice and be fully satisfied. This isn't a traditional Cajun restaurant--it's more of that LA-style seafood boil vibe--so come ready to get messy and dig in. Portions are decent and it's definitely satisfying if you're craving something rich and flavorful.
